Maximus Dan (born Edghill Thomas in 1979 in Carenage, Trinidad and Tobago) is a Soca / Dancehall artist.

After working with Jamaican producer Danny Browne between 1997 and 2000 and producing heavily Dancehall Reggae influenced music, Maximus Dan moved more in the direction of Soca and has developed his own unique blend styles. His biggest hit to date was "fighter" which was made for the Soca Warriors (the Trinidad and Tobago national football team) in 2006. "Fighter" became the rallying song for the first ever appearance by Trinidad and Tobago in the finals of the World Cup of Football (in Germany).

His song Love Generation is featured on the EA Cricket 07 game for the PC and Playstation.

Most notable among his cohort of recent Soca stars is Bunji Garlin.
